Carolina Herrera Fall 2011 | New York Fashion Week

Carolina Herrera’s fall 2011 runway show was certainly not short of timeless sophistication which the label has become renowned for. Playing with classic silhouettes, Herrera gave those in attendance a truly autumn outing with heavy jackets, fur trims and wool separates. Offsetting the voluminous outerwear, feminine shapes took to the catwalk in vibrant hues of citrus orange and sky blue.
